In The Gay Science Nietzsche wrote: God is dead. God remains dead. And we have killed him. How shall we comfort ourselves, the murderers of all murderers? What was holiest and mightiest of all that the world has yet owned has bled to death under our knives . . . Is not the greatness of this deed too great for us? Must we ourselves not become gods simply to appear worthy of it?
